The story is about Bert who lives on a farm. Like you, George, he’s a curious pooch, smelling everything everywhere – and he loves to roll in stuff. You can say he’s a sniff and whiff pup! Sound familiar, George?
One day, the farm gate is open and Bert follows his nose and gets lost. When he asked for help, no-one would help him because he was smelly. When he thought he was lost forever, someone lent him a paw. Like the many times when Mum got a phone call because you were lost in your own world, Georgie!
The story is loosely based on the real life Bert. He was found, apparently, on the North Circular (a busy intersection in north London), and taken to the Mayhew rescue centre in North London. He was adopted from there.

Bert Smells is an “out and back” story. You can be different or lost, but there will always be someone there for you. In these difficult times when we feel lost, just know there is always someone there to help us – whether it be family, friends or organisations.
